It is crucial to take photos and videos of the scene of your accident as soon as you can and while you still recall the details. This visual evidence can strengthen your claim, and make it more persuasive for a jury. Your attorney will also collect all your records. These records could include receipts, bills, diagnostic reports, discharge orders and other pertinent documentation.
Your attorney will also request any additional documents from the other party's insurance company, as well as the lien holders if there are any. Liens are the amounts owed from other parties, like health care providers or workers' compensation insurance companies, that have priority in receiving settlement payments. Your attorney will try to reduce these liens as much as possible so that you get the most amount from your settlement.

You must file a lawsuit within a specific period of time after the accident, also known as the statute of limitations. The time frame varies based the location you reside in, but typically, it is three years after the date of the collision. If you are suing an entity within a city, such as the NYCHA, then the time frame is much shorter.

Medical expenses can mount up quickly after a car accident. This is why it is essential to keep track of all your medical bills and other documentation. You should also see your physician as soon as you can after the accident. This will help avoid complications that may arise from your injuries.
A doctor can conduct an examination of the body and order any necessary tests. They can also suggest the best treatment plan to ensure that you recover as fast as is possible. It is important to remember that some injuries might not manifest until a few days or even weeks after the incident.
In New York, those who have PIP or personal health insurance coverage can receive immediate financial assistance for their medical expenses. However, they'll need to file a lawsuit against the responsible party to recover compensation for other losses.
